    What to bring on test day(s) 

     As well as your identity document,

    you may need to bring two recent (not

    more than six months old) identical

    passport-sized photographs. Check

    your test documentation to see

    whether this applies to you.

    The only other items you can bring into

    the test are pens, pencils and erasers.

    Remember to switch off your mobile

    phone: failure to do so could result in

    you being disqualified!

    Taking the test

    You will do the Listening test first, and

    then the Reading and Writing. The

    Speaking test may be on a different

    day, up to seven days before or after

    the written papers.

    Remember that you must complete the

    answer paper in pencil as it will be

    processed by a machine that can’t

    read ink.

     At the end of the test, stay in your seat

    until you are given permission to leave

    the room.

    W hat if I can’t hear  the Listening test 

    recor ding?  If  you can’t hear pr oper ly, or  

    if you have any other  questions, put up your hand and the invigilator  will come and talk to you. ( Note that you can’t ask the invigilator  to explain questions to you! ) 

    If , after   the test, you  f eel  ther e ar e  any  issuesthat have aff ected your per formance, make sur e you tell the invigilator immediately.
